Landlord Law Blog roundup from 8 April

This post is more than 12 years old

April 13, 2013 by Tessa Shepperson

I spent much of yesterday doing some clips of the talks recorded at our recent conference.

So if you want to see what Ben looks like, have a play of the video below:


But what happened on the blog this week?

Monday

Uk discussion forums for landlords

I take a look at the six top discussion forums, as identified by the NLA, and give you som links so you can take a look for yourself.  Find them here …

Tuesday

My landlord has returned my unprotected deposit – can I still claim the penalty?

A landlord shoves the deposit in cash through the letter box, along with a s21 notice, witnessed by the police.  Is this legal?  Find out here…

Wednesday

How to get rid of your letting agent – a new guide for landlords

Lots of landlords join my Landlord Law service after a bad experience with their letting agent – but how can they get out of their agency agreement?  This new ‘trail’ gives guidance.  Read about it here …

Thursday

Tenant believed to be in prison – what should the landlord do?

She heard it on the grapevine – and the rent is not being paid.  What is the best course of action here?  See my suggestions here …

Friday

Ben Reeve Lewis Friday newsround #102

Ben meets up with the people at the National Landlords Association, as well as discussing gavvers, making a pop at the bedroom tax and reflecting on musical protest.  Find out more here …
